Zátěžový tester informačních a komunikačních technologií (Information and communication technology stress tester)

Datum publikování: 31.08.2022
Autoři: Marek Sikora, Václav Zeman, Petr Číka, Vlastimil Člupek, Petr Blažek, Zdeněk Martinásek

Rubrika: Komunikační technologie

Jazyk (Language): CZ
Abstrakt (Abstract): As part of the design and optimization of information and communication technology (ICT) systems, one of the steps is to test systems under extreme load using so-called Denial of Service (DoS) or Distributed DoS (DDoS) attacks. Tests are done either using specialized hardware (HW) devices or by creating workloads using software (SW) distributed systems. In addition to the above tests, it is also often necessary to verify the behavior of the ICT infrastructure under predefined transmission conditions. Specialized HW and SW network emulators are used for this purpose, which allow defining the properties of the transmission network. The paper describes an innovative system, based on open-source technologies, which represents an alternative to closed-source commercial solutions, combines both functions, i.e. a load tester and a network emulator in one device, and the advantages of such a system are shown.

Rozšíření Shannonovy teorie utajovacích kryptosystémů založené na latinských obdélnících (An extension of Shannon`s theory of secrecy cryptosystems based on Latin rectangles)

Datum publikování: 30.08.2022
Autoři: Karel Burda

Rubrika: Komunikační technologie

Jazyk (Language): CZ
Abstrakt (Abstract): The paper extends Shannon's classical theory of secrecy cryptosystems. This extension is based on the representation of ciphers by Latin rectangles. Based on this representation, a model is derived that uses the so-called valence of cryptograms, which is the number of all meaningful messages produced by decrypting a given cryptogram with all possible keys. Furthermore, the paper derives a lower guaranteed bound on the valence of any cipher with K keys and N inputs, of which M inputs are messages. That parameter allows quantifying the resistance of ciphers to brute force attack. The model is general, illustrative and uses a simpler mathematical apparatus than existing theory. It can thus be used as an introduction to the theory of secrecy cryptosystems.

Tiket útoky proti autentizačnímu protokolu Kerberos (Ticket attacks on the Kerberos authentication protocol)

Datum publikování: 30.06.2022
Autoři: Willi Lazarov, Antonín Bohačík

Rubrika: Komunikační technologie

Jazyk (Language): CZ
Abstrakt (Abstract): The paper deals with the security of the Kerberos network authentication protocol. The basic principles and the detailed flow of communication between a client and a system using the Kerberos protocol are explained in the introduction. The paper also points out the existing security threats in the form of ticket attacks and presents the method of their execution including predispositions. Post-exploitation attacks are problematic to detect, and thus administrators of systems that use the Kerberos protocol should be more familiar with the protection options. Particular ticket attacks are analyzed, and the paper concludes by describing security measures that can detect attacks presented and prevent or minimize their impact.

Multi RAT gateway for maritime container monitoring

Datum publikování: 30.06.2022
Autoři: Petr Musil, Tomáš Roško, Stanislav Fučík

Rubrika: Komunikační technologie

Jazyk (Language): EN
Abstrakt (Abstract): Increasing complexity of international transport leads to higher requirements and expectations of shipping container tracking. However shipping transport faces specific technical challenges, such as the need to send accurate data, often and with low energy consumption. This article deals with the specific design of a tracking device, which addresses current requirements. The gateway offers Multi RAT (Multiple Radio Access Technology) which combines benefits of satellite and mobile networks to monitor shipping containers and its inner conditions with high energy efficiency.

Dvourozměrná detekce hran pro distribuovaný optovláknový detekční systém (Two-Dimensional Edge Detection for Distributed Fiber Optical Sensing System )

Datum publikování: 23.05.2022
Autoři: Pavel Záviška, Petr Dejdar, Petr Münster, Tomáš Horváth

Rubrika: Komunikační technologie

Jazyk (Language): CZ
Abstrakt (Abstract): A comparison of two-dimensional edge detection approaches in a phase OTDR (Φ-OTDR) sensor system for perimeter disturbance detection is presented in this paper. To locate vibrations on the sensing fiber, Sobel and Prewitt operators are used to detect vertical edges in the processed image, which consists of consecutive Rayleigh backscattering traces. The perimeter disturbance is simulated using three different scenarios (loudspeaker, walk, and climbing over the fence) and the results of presented methods are evaluated using signal-to-noise ratio (SNR) and spatial resolution.
